Prep Time: 20 mins
Cook Time: 30 mins
Total Time: 50 mins
Cuisine: Baking
Serves: 8 servings
Ingredients
- 2 cups grated carrots
- 1 cup apples, peeled and grated
- 1 cup sugar
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 2 cups fl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 3 eggs
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9-inch round cake pan or line it with parchment paper.
- In a large mixing bowl, grate the carrots and apples using a box grater. Ensure to peel the apples first and remove any excess moisture by gently pressing with a paper towel.
- In a separate large bowl, whisk together the sugar, vegetable oil, and eggs until the mixture becomes smooth and slightly frothy.
- In another bowl, sift together the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t to ensure even distribution of dry ingredients.
- Gradually fold the dry ingredient mixture into the wet ingredients, mixing gently until just combined. Be careful not to overmix the batter.
- Gently fold in the grated carrots and apples, distributing them evenly throughout the batter.
-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an, smoothing the top with a spatula to ensure an even surface.
-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
- Optional: Once cooled, dust with powdered sugar or frost with cream cheese frosting before serving.
Tips
- Moisture is Key: Gently press out excess moisture from grated apples and carrots to prevent a soggy cake.
- Don't Overmix: Mix the batter just until ingredients are combined to keep the cake tender and light.
- Check for Doneness: Use the toothpick test - it should come out clean with just a few moist crumbs.
- Cooling Matters: Allow the cake to cool completely before frosting to prevent melting and sliding.
- Storage Tip: This cake stays moist for 3-4 days when stored in an airtight container at room temperature.
- Flavor Boost: Consider adding chopped nuts or raisins for extra texture and depth of flavor.
- Make it Ahead: The cake actually tastes better the next day as flavors continue to meld together.
